About this course

This specialist masters degree appeals to practitioners in the field of criminal justice, particularly: solicitors, barristers, CPS employees and police officers. Lawyers at the start of their career have found this course helps them to build their knowledge and expertise in a specialist area.

You will learn about fundamental principles upon which the criminal justice system is based by positioning them in a comparative context.

We have designed the degree to allow you to examine crucial areas of criminal litigation in far greater depth than usually possible, either at undergraduate level or during a professional training course.

Our specialist programme is the first postgraduate degree in the UK to be dedicated exclusively to the critical study of criminal litigation. You will benefit from a unique qualification.
